“`html
Electronics Design Insights
🔥 Unveiling the Secret World of SoC Chip Design Flow! 🚀
Are you ready to dive into the fascinating realm of SoC chip design flow? In this comprehensive guide, we’ll unravel the mysteries behind the process, from concept to completion. Get ready to witness the magic of modern electronics design!
What is SoC Chip Design Flow?
SoC, or System on Chip, refers to an integrated circuit that integrates all the components of a computer or other electronic system on a single chip. The SoC chip design flow is the process of designing, verifying, and manufacturing these complex integrated circuits. It’s a meticulous process that requires a deep understanding of various disciplines, including digital design, analog design, and system architecture.
Understanding the SoC Chip Design Flow
The SoC chip design flow can be broken down into several key stages, each with its own set of challenges and objectives. Let’s take a closer look at these stages:
1. Requirements Gathering and Analysis
The first step in the SoC chip design flow is to gather and analyze the requirements for the chip. This involves understanding the intended use of the chip, its performance specifications, power consumption, and other critical factors.
2. Architecture Design
Once the requirements are clear, the next step is to design the architecture of the SoC. This includes defining the major components, such as the CPU, GPU, memory, and I/O interfaces, as well as the interconnects between them.
3. Digital Design
In this stage, the digital components of the SoC are designed using hardware description languages (HDLs) like VHDL or Verilog. The design is then simulated to ensure it meets the specified requirements.
4. Analog Design
Analog components, such as power management circuits and sensors, are designed separately from the digital components. These designs are also simulated to verify their functionality.
5. Verification
Verification is a critical stage in the SoC chip design flow. It involves testing the design to ensure it works as intended and meets all the specified requirements. This includes functional verification, timing analysis, and power analysis.
6. Place and Route
After verification, the design is placed and routed. This process involves mapping the design onto the physical layout of the SoC and determining the optimal placement and routing of the components.
7. Fabrication
The final step in the SoC chip design flow is fabrication. The design is sent to a semiconductor foundry for manufacturing. The foundry uses photolithography, etching, and other processes to create the physical SoC chip.
Challenges in SoC Chip Design Flow
Designing an SoC chip is no small feat. There are several challenges that engineers face throughout the process:
- Complexity: SoC chips are incredibly complex, with millions or even billions of transistors.
- Integration: Integrating various components, such as CPUs, GPUs, and memory, into a single chip is a significant challenge.
- Power Consumption: Reducing power consumption is crucial for mobile and battery-powered devices.
- Cost: The cost of designing and manufacturing SoC chips is high, and engineers must optimize the design to reduce costs.
Conclusion
The SoC chip design flow is a fascinating and complex process that requires a multidisciplinary approach. By understanding the various stages and challenges involved, engineers can create innovative and efficient SoC chips that power the devices we use every day. So, are you ready to embark on this exciting journey into the world of SoC chip design?
Further Reading
For those who want to delve deeper into the world of SoC chip design, here are some additional resources:
“`